2-Methyloctadecanoic acid

Suppliers

Names

[ CAS No. ]:
7217-83-6

[ Name ]:
2-Methyloctadecanoic acid

Chemical & Physical Properties

[ Melting Point ]:
55.2-59 °C(lit.)

[ Molecular Formula ]:
C19H38O2

[ Molecular Weight ]:
298.50400

[ Exact Mass ]:
298.28700

[ PSA ]:
37.30000

[ LogP ]:
6.57850
